Defining Sonar: Silent Surveillance Beneath the Surface

Sonar—Sound Navigation and Ranging—uses sound waves to detect and map underwater objects without visual intrusion. Unlike traditional fishing methods reliant on sight or physical tracking, sonar penetrates darkness and murky waters, revealing fish schools, reef structures, and terrain
